What we collect

When you buy Name, delivery address, email, phone. Order contents and history. Payment status — not your card number, which goes to the payment provider and never to us.

When you create an account Login credentials, and anything you choose to save such as saved addresses.

When you sell Business name and legal entity details, GSTIN and PAN, bank account details, pickup addresses, the identity of the people who operate the account, and the documents supplied for verification.

When you contact us Whatever you put in the message, your contact details, and the IP address and browser the message came from.

Who it goes to

Sellers receive your name, delivery address and phone — only what is needed to fulfil the order. The Seller Agreement forbids them using it for marketing, adding you to a list, selling it on, or contacting you about anything other than your order.

Carriers receive what is needed to deliver: name, address, phone.

The payment provider handles the payment. Your card details go to them, not to us.

Service providers who run parts of the platform — hosting, search, email delivery, analytics — under contract, for those purposes only.

Authorities, where the law requires it.

We do not sell your personal data. Not to sellers, not to advertisers, not to anyone.

Security

Access is restricted to the people who need it. Data in transit is encrypted. Payment details never reach our systems. Seller KYC documents are held with restricted access and an audit trail.
